To determine whether any of the given equations show a proportional relationship, we need to analyze them. A proportional relationship typically has the following characteristics:

  1. Directly proportional - If one quantity increases, the other quantity increases as well, at a constant rate.
  2. Linear relationship through the origin - The equation can generally be expressed in the form \( y = kx \), where \( k \) is a constant. In this case, if \( x = 0 \), then \( y \) must also equal 0.
